Fiat pricing, crypto collection
Set your prices in USD (more fiat currencies on the way). Customers pay in crypto at real-time exchange rates from providers like CoinMarketCap and CoinAPI.
On-chain verification
TRXN monitors blockchain data sources to verify that payments match your invoices by amount, address, and timeframe.
Slippage margin handling
Crypto prices move between checkout and confirmation. Configurable slippage tolerance ensures valid payments aren't rejected due to minor fluctuations.
Subscriptions
Model complex billing: free trials, promotional rates, graduated pricing. Each phase defines its own duration, price, and currency.
Transaction allocation
One crypto transaction can be allocated across multiple invoices: partial payments, overpayments, and multi-invoice splits.
Sandbox environments
Spin up multiple isolated sandboxes to test different configurations side by side. Create invoices, simulate payments, and verify behavior before going live.
x402 gateway
A hosted gateway that handles the x402 protocol for you. Configure an endpoint, share your gateway URL, and TRXN manages the 402 flow, settlement through your chosen facilitator, daily invoicing, and customer tracking. Zero protocol code required.
